Can anyone recommend natural headache/migraine relief? Since moving to southern Ontario I get headaches whenever a storm is coming. Usually it is just enough of a headache to notice- i take a few advil or sudafed and it is gone. However, last week we had a bad few days of storms and I got a migraine for the first time ever- it was awful. I went to the doctors today to see what I could get if/when the migraine happens again. I am VERY sensitive to medication- can't have anything with codeine, I'm allergic to amoxicillian- (both of these medications make my heart race and beat all funny) so my doctor said I'd end up in emerg if she gave me migraine medication (and to tell you the truth- i wasn't crazy on the idea of taking anything too strong)- so basically she said all I can do is take 3 advil and a gravol (dramamine). I am considering trying acupuncture (SOOOOO nervous) and was wondering if anyone else had other suggestions. |

However, I haven't found anything (aside from caffeine) that can help....and even that doesn't help that much. I suffer from migraines and have for years. The ONLY thing I have ever taken that totally takes it away is Maxalt. My doctor prescribed it for me years ago. There are two forms of it..one that you swallow (pill form) or one that goes under your tongue and melts. I'm telling you, Maxalt is wonderful. Now they do make me groggy but it doesn't last long. When I get a full blown migraine, I cannot function. Maxalt works wonders. It's like the migraine just melts away~ |
I forgot to mention that Maxalt is not something that you have to take on a daily basis. You only take one when you feel a migraine coming on. Quote:
